.TianaiCaptchaV2_container__umyRG{width:min(100%,320px);margin:0 auto;color:#e5e7eb;-webkit-user-select:none;-moz-user-select:none;user-select:none;text-align:left}.TianaiCaptchaV2_tip__LC7VG{margin-bottom:5px;color:#e5e7eb;font-size:15px;font-weight:700;line-height:1.4}.TianaiCaptchaV2_imageWrap__c_55c{position:relative;width:320px;max-width:100%;height:180px;overflow:hidden;border-radius:6px 6px 0 0;background:#111827}.TianaiCaptchaV2_background__ozWgG{display:block;width:100%;height:100%;-o-object-fit:cover;object-fit:cover;pointer-events:none;-webkit-user-drag:none}.TianaiCaptchaV2_rotatingBackground__WRL1h{transform-origin:center}.TianaiCaptchaV2_piece__U13S5{position:absolute;pointer-events:none;-webkit-user-drag:none;filter:drop-shadow(0 3px 8px rgba(17,24,39,.28))}.TianaiCaptchaV2_scrapeCover__kDzbG{position:absolute;top:0;right:0;bottom:0;min-width:0;border-radius:0 5px 5px 0;background:linear-gradient(135deg,rgba(255,255,255,.24),rgba(255,255,255,0) 42%),repeating-linear-gradient(135deg,rgba(255,255,255,.13) 0 8px,rgba(15,23,42,.04) 8px 16px),#d8d8d8;box-shadow:-6px 0 9px rgba(255,255,255,.9);color:#6b7280;display:flex;align-items:center;justify-content:center;font-size:15px;font-weight:700;overflow:hidden;pointer-events:none;transition:left 60ms linear,opacity .18s ease;white-space:nowrap}.TianaiCaptchaV2_empty__yFfWz,.TianaiCaptchaV2_loading__lv3FF{min-height:220px;display:flex;align-items:center;justify-content:center;color:#cbd5e1;font-size:14px}.TianaiCaptchaV2_refresh__5J8li{width:20px;height:20px;border:0;border-radius:3px;display:inline-flex;align-items:center;justify-content:center;color:#64748b;background:transparent;cursor:pointer}.TianaiCaptchaV2_refresh__5J8li:hover{color:#0f172a;background:#f1f5f9}.TianaiCaptchaV2_refresh__5J8li:disabled{cursor:not-allowed;opacity:.6}.TianaiCaptchaV2_track__we8v5{position:relative;height:34px;width:320px;max-width:100%;overflow:hidden;margin:11px 0 0;border:1px solid #f5f5f5;border-radius:4px;background:#f5f5f5;box-sizing:content-box}.TianaiCaptchaV2_progress__4fD7X{position:absolute;inset:0 auto 0 0;border:1px solid #00f4ab;border-radius:5px 0 0 5px;background:#a9ffe5;opacity:.5;pointer-events:none;top:-1px;left:-1px;height:32px}.TianaiCaptchaV2_handle__fMhOE{position:absolute;top:-6px;left:0;width:48px;height:45px;border:0;border-radius:6px;display:inline-flex;align-items:center;justify-content:center;color:#334155;background:#fff;box-shadow:0 2px 8px rgba(15,23,42,.18);cursor:grab;touch-action:none;z-index:1}.TianaiCaptchaV2_handle__fMhOE:active{cursor:grabbing}.TianaiCaptchaV2_handle__fMhOE:disabled{cursor:not-allowed}.TianaiCaptchaV2_hint__tB9ya{position:absolute;inset:0 56px;display:flex;align-items:center;justify-content:center;color:#88949d;font-size:14px;pointer-events:none;white-space:nowrap}.TianaiCaptchaV2_bottomBar__piY74{height:30px;display:flex;align-items:center;justify-content:space-between;padding-top:10px}.TianaiCaptchaV2_logoText__7rnk_{color:#cbd5e1;font-size:11px;font-weight:700;letter-spacing:0}.TianaiCaptchaV2_status__NCyPj{min-height:25px;margin-top:8px;display:flex;align-items:center;justify-content:center;gap:6px;color:#64748b;font-size:13px;text-align:center}.TianaiCaptchaV2_fail__M25_O{width:100%;padding:8px 10px;border:1px solid rgba(248,113,113,.62);border-radius:6px;flex-direction:column;gap:3px;background:rgba(127,29,29,.25);color:#ff6b6b;font-weight:700;line-height:1.35}.TianaiCaptchaV2_failHint__D0zTZ{color:#fecaca;font-size:12px;font-weight:600}.TianaiCaptchaV2_spin__txDWf{animation:TianaiCaptchaV2_spin__txDWf 1s linear infinite}@keyframes TianaiCaptchaV2_spin__txDWf{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}